Blanca Kent Obituary

KENT Blanca Kent, M.D., age 85, passed away Monday, April 7, 2008, at Knox Community Hospital in Mt. Vernon, Ohio. Born on May 1, 1922, to Benjamin Povoli and Nelly Pinto in Salta, Argentina. She was a long-time resident of Bexley and later moved to Mt. Vernon. A Dietician, Physician, Pediatric Surgeon, and Associate Professor at Ohio State University, her distinguishing accomplishments include: medical degree from Faculade Nacional de Medicina, Universidad de Brasil; Masters and Ph.D. from The Ohio State University; Medical internships and residencies in Bolivia, Oregon, California, Ohio, Brazil, University of London, England and at Alder Hay Hospital in Liverpool, England. She was the personal dietician to the president of Bolivia prior to finishing medical school. She was a past Chief Surgical Resident at Columbus Children's Hospital, Director of Surgical Research at Columbus Children's Hospital working on preservation by hyperbaric oxygen, partial liver transplantation and fetal skin graphing; and Associate Professor of Surgery at The Ohio State University. She received numerous awards, research grants and Fellowships including some from the Instituto Nacional de la Nutricion, The American College of Surgeons and the Columbus Surgical Society. She published and presented numerous papers for various medical journals around the world. She was on the attending staff at The Ohio State University Hospitals and on the active staff at Children's Hospital where she was responsible for groundbreaking research and practice of skin grafting techniques for burn patients. She saved or improved the lives of countless children and their families through her private practice that spanned more than 30 years. Preceded in death by her husband Charles H. Kent.
